Abstract
The invention provides a fixing structure for cores in a casting mould for cases of mining machinery, which structurally comprises a bottom case and positioning screws, wherein a bottom core is arranged in the bottom case, a transitional core and a top core are arranged on the bottom core, hangers are embedded in the bottom core, tails of the positioning screws are embedded in the bottom core and hooked with the hangers, both the transitional core and the top core are provided with positioning holes inserted with the positioning screws, and lock nuts are screwed at tops of the positioning screws so as to press the top core tightly.
Description
Technical field
The present invention relates to the fixed structure in loam core in a kind of mining machinery box casting mould.
Background technology
Casing is the important composition parts of mining machinery coal pulverizer, will carry at work huge weight, to having relatively high expectations of wear-resisting, heat-resisting, fatigue resistance.In traditional casting process, loam core in casting die mostly interfixes in lateral location, but be subject to the impact of mining machinery coal pulverizer casing self structure, applicant finds that in design casting die traditional loam core is connected and fixed structure inapplicable, therefore needs to redesign the loam core fixed structure that the scope of application is wider.
Summary of the invention
For solving above-mentioned technical problem, the invention provides the fixed structure in loam core in the mining machinery box casting mould that a kind of reliable in structure, the scope of application are wider.
Technical scheme of the present invention is, the fixed structure in loam core in a kind of a kind of mining machinery box casting mould with following structure is provided, it comprises under casing, in under casing, be provided with bottom loam core, bottom loam core is provided with transition zone loam core and top layer loam core, it also comprises positioning screw, is embedded with extension member in bottom loam core, the afterbody of positioning screw be embedded in bottom loam core and with hang member phase hook; On transition zone loam core and top layer loam core, be equipped with locating hole and be enclosed within successively on positioning screw, the top of positioning screw is rotary with lock nut and top layer loam core is compressed.
Adopt after said structure, the present invention has following remarkable advantage and beneficial effect:
By positioning screw being embedded in bottom loam core with extension member, after loam core is compressed, positioning screw is fixing reliable, remaining loam core just can superpose successively and be placed on bottom loam core by locating hole like this, the mode finally screwing by lock nut and positioning screw is strained and fixed loam core, Stability Analysis of Structures, reliable, this structure, without the lateral space of utilizing mould, is subject to the impact of mould self structure less, and the scope of application is also wider.
As improvement, on top layer loam core, be also provided with the concave station extending along locating hole, lock nut is positioned at this concave station and screws the rear molding sand sealing of using with positioning screw.So just lock nut can be hidden in loam core, less on the external structure impact in loam core, be conducive to keep the integrality of loam core structural entity, be conducive to the operation of subsequent handling.

detailed description of the invention:
Below in conjunction with drawings and the specific embodiments, the invention will be further described.
As shown in Figure 1, Figure 2, Figure 3 shows, the fixed structure in loam core in mining machinery box casting mould of the present invention, it comprises under casing 1, in under casing 1, be provided with bottom loam core 2, bottom loam core 2 is provided with transition zone loam core 3 and top layer loam core 4, and it also comprises positioning screw 5, hangs member 6, hang member 6 and be embedded in bottom loam core 2, the afterbody of positioning screw 5 is inserted in bottom loam core 2 and then loam core is compressed with extension member 6 phase hooks can be by fixing to extension member 6 and positioning screw 5; On transition zone loam core 3 and top layer loam core 4, be equipped with locating hole 7, then be enclosed within successively on positioning screw 5, finally screw top layer loam core 4 is compressed with lock nut 8 at the top of positioning screw 5, installation that so just can whole loam core structure is fixing relatively good, reliable, and be not subject to the impact of mould side structure, the scope of application is wider.
As corrective measure, on top layer loam core 4, be also provided with the concave station 9 extending along locating hole 7, so just can make lock nut 8 when locking be positioned at this concave station 9 and with screw at positioning screw 5 after fill up then sealing of concave station 9 with molding sand 10, the globality of loam core structure is better.
